Dane County holds committee meeting on issues regarding homelessness

Dane County held a virtual committee meeting discussing homelessness issues in Dane County on Monday focusing on the building of a new homeless shelter in Madison and the future of the Dairy Drive homeless encampment.

In 2025, nearly 800 people in Madison were reported as being homeless, which is a seven percent increase from 2024, according to an annual point-in-time survey.

In addition, the City of Madison’s new homeless shelter, a $27 million project, started construction in December 2023, and is scheduled for completion in December 2025, with an anticipated opening in spring 2026, according to City of Madison community development manager Linette Rhodes — who presented details of the shelter during the meeting…
